![]() |
Alle Tabellen einer Mysql-DB auslesen
Hallo! Ich wollt mal fragen ob eine Methode oder sowas gibt mit der man alle Tabellen einer Mysql-Db auslesen kann. Ich benutze die Zeos-Komponente Version 6.0.6-beta.
Vielen Dank schon mal :D |
SQL-Query:
SQL-Code:
SHOW TABLES FROM databasename
|
danke! :mrgreen:
hmm und wie kann ich das ergebnis in einer combobox anzeigen?? ich hab ja keinen namen auf den ich mich beziehen kann (für FieldbyName()) |
Hallo Sergej,
dann benutze doch den Fields Array. |
ich wäre für en codebeispiel dankbar...ich hab nämlich noch nicht sooo viel ahnung von delphi :mrgreen:
|
Hallo Sergej,
es sollte so funktionieren (qryTables soll die o.g. Query sein, cbTables die ComboBox) :
Delphi-Quellcode:
cbTables.Clear;
qryTables.First; while Not qryTables.Eof do begin cbTables.items.Add(qryTables.Fields[0].AsString); qryTables.Next; end; |
Vielen Dank! Es tut jetzt *freu* :mrgreen:
|
Re: Alle Tabellen einer Mysql-DB auslesen
Hallo,
weiß jemand, ob man das auch mit den dbexpress-Komponenten hinbekommt ? Danke Skeeve |
Alle Zeitangaben in WEZ +1. Es ist jetzt 08:16 Uhr. |
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024-2025 by Thomas Breitkreuz